Abstract
This paper studies the physical layout of the routing links and control links within a multi-hop packet switched Data Vortex photonic network. For minimum signal interference, the proposed physical layout allows for non-crossing electrical control links while keeping the same simple routing patterns at specified cylinder levels for optical routing.
